kcusage statistcs

Hy,

In some servers, i get stats with kcusage for example:

kcusage -m nfile
Tunable: nfile
Setting: 90000

how can I get all the servers to collect stats ?

does it only do it if you have alarms configured ?

Re: kcusage statistcs

Check whether kernel monitoring is enabled using:

kcalarm -m status

If its not enabled you can turn it on using:

kcalarm -m on

If it's enabled but not collecting data you can check if it has been having a problem by looking at the EMS registrar log file (the EMS registrar is responsible for intermittently running kcmond which logs the data for kcusage)

Look in the log:

/etc/opt/resmon/log/api.log

Duncan spot on ,as you said kcalarm status was off.

Working now thnx.
